Multi-room smart mapping
The majority of robot vacuums and mop machines come with a mapping feature that allows the user to create an interactive map of their home. The map will help the robot avoid obstacles and clean floors with ease. The mapping feature is particularly useful in large homes where the furniture can make it difficult for robots to navigate.
Most vacuum and mop robots can be linked to an app to save maps, set cleaning schedules or select cleaning options. The app also provides real-time information on how the device is doing and the amount of cleaning it has done and what floors it has covered. It can even tell you when the battery is getting low.
To begin an entirely new mapping session, you must bring the robot into the space that you want to be mapped. It is advisable to prepare the area by removing any clutter, moving loose furniture or objects and securing cables. It is also an excellent idea to optimize and enhance the room layout if possible.

The mapping capabilities of robot hoover mops can be improved by adding virtual walls or no-go zones. The no-go zones will prevent the robot from entering specific areas of the house, and can be altered as needed. The virtual wall can be used to protect fragile objects in rooms from harm.
You can edit a Smart Map at any time by clicking the map editing icon within the app and then selecting room dividers, zones, or room labels. You can also change the orientation of the map, or rename rooms.
You can customize the behavior of your robotic cleaner and mop cleaner using the Smart Map feature. This allows you to create different cleaning modes for each room. You can also set a designated cleaning direction for the vacuum and mop robot to follow.

Mapping technology allows your robot cleaner to travel without hitting obstacles and optimizes its route in real time. It could take several mapping runs to map your entire home, depending on how large the area is and how complex the environment is. Maps can be dynamically updated to avoid new obstacles and keep track of changes over time.
Smart navigation features can help your vacuum cleaner and mop avoid obstacles such as stairs and other obstacles that could cause it to become stuck. They also can detect and avoid objects such as shoes, wires and pet waste. Some models employ object identification technology, which recognizes a variety of household objects and teaches itself from each experience to improve navigation over time.

Easy cleaning
While vacuuming keeps fine dust and dirt from settling on floors, mopping is often the best robotic mop and vacuum way to get tough dirt off vinyl, tile and hardwood surfaces. Fortunately, many robotics that double as vacuums also take care of mopping, doing duo tasks at once to save time and effort.
To do this, all robot mop models pass a pad with cleaning solution across floors, but the best models also use an incline-rotating mop head and apply consistent pressure for more thorough scrub. They adjust the level of water in accordance with the flooring type and have a mode which applies more pressure on tiles. ECOVACS' Mopbots, for instance, feature a specific sensor that detects different stain sizes and adjusts the water level accordingly.
